3 Tips for Choosing Kitchen Remodeling Contractors

selecting kitchen remodeling professionals

When you're choosing a kitchen remodeling contractor, the first step is to check their qualifications thoroughly. It's crucial to ensure that they are licensed and insured, as this protects you from any liability in case something goes wrong during the project.

Additionally, look into their past experience specifically with kitchen remodels. For example, a contractor who has completed similar projects successfully can demonstrate their ability to handle the unique challenges that may arise in your kitchen.

Next, take the time to research their specialties. Not all contractors focus on the same areas, so it's helpful to see if they have a particular style or approach that resonates with you.

Request a portfolio of their past work to get an idea of their craftsmanship and design sensibilities. Also, check if they are members of professional organizations like the National Kitchen and Bath Association (NKBA), as this can indicate a commitment to industry standards and ongoing education.

Finally, make sure to compare estimates from a few different contractors. A detailed proposal will give you insight into what you can expect in terms of costs and timelines.

Don't hesitate to ask for references or check online reviews to get feedback on their reliability and professionalism. These steps will not only make the selection process easier but will also ensure you find a contractor who aligns well with your vision for your kitchen transformation.

Compare Estimates and References

When it comes to choosing the right contractor for your kitchen remodel, comparing estimates and references is crucial. To get started, gather detailed, written estimates from several contractors. This step is important because it helps you evaluate not just the costs, but also the materials and labor each contractor plans to use.

Look for estimates that clearly outline the scope of work. This way, you can spot any differences between the proposals. For example, if one contractor offers to include custom cabinetry while another suggests stock options, it can explain why the first might charge a premium.

After that, ask each contractor for references. Reach out to recent clients to get their opinions on key aspects like communication, professionalism, and how well the contractor stuck to the expected timeline. Consistent feedback from several clients can provide insights into whether a contractor is dependable and delivers quality work.

As you sift through the estimates and reference feedback, keep your own project goals front and center. You want a contractor who not only understands your vision but can also transform it into reality.

Ultimately, this thorough comparison process will empower you to make a well-informed choice, ensuring you find a contractor who meets your expectations and successfully brings your kitchen remodel to life.
